BASF Ultracur3D ST 45 Transparent by Forward AM is a premium acrylate-based standard resin distinguished by exceptional clarity and high mechanical load-bearing capacity. This transparent resin offers an excellent balance of hardness and flexibility, ensuring printed parts are resistant to breakage. Featuring high resolution, it accurately reproduces the finest details, making it ideal for applications where aesthetics and functionality go hand in hand. The resin is optimized for common DLP and LCD printers in the 385 to 405 nm wavelength range and exhibits low viscosity for reliable layer adhesion. After printing, models should be cleaned in isopropyl alcohol and fully post-cured with UV light (e.g., 405 nm) to achieve maximum strength. Its application range is versatile: it is perfect for detailed miniatures, functional engineering prototypes, transparent enclosures, and dental models such as orthodontic patterns. Handle with care: always wear protective gloves and work in a well-ventilated area, as the resin may cause skin irritation. Post-processing steps include removing support structures and optional polishing for a crystal-clear surface.
